Car Accessories Sellers in Kottarakara, India - Real Reviews & Rating | VouchKart
Car Accessories in Kottarakara
Browse top-rated Instagram car accessories sellers in Kottarakara. Compare reviews, delivery success rates, and buyer experiences before making a purchase.